    Performance by the Boston Cello Quartet.
    Live at Pickman Hall, Cambridge, MA on November 22, 2010.
    Arrangement by Blaise Déjardin (©2005)

      It's the opening bass solo in Mahler's Symphony No. 1 Movement 3 (the "Hunter's Funeral").
      The first cellist is holding his bow in the german style bass bow-hold and playing high on the C-string to imitate the sound/look of the bass solo! The pizzicato is meant to be the timpani.
      The melody of the theme is Frère Jacques but set in D minor.
